Nitric oxide signalling by selective β(2)-adrenoceptor stimulation prevents ACh-induced inhibition of β(2)-stimulated Ca(2+) current in cat atrial myocytes

The present study determined the effects of acetylcholine (ACh) on the L-type Ca(2+) current (I(Ca,l)) stimulated by β(1)- or β(2)-adrenergic receptor (AR) agonists in cat atrial myocytes.
